New Mill Capital is auctioning high speed bottling and packaging equipment no longer required by Milwaukee Brewing. Milwaukee Brewing was founded in 1997. The firm brews craft beers, including seasonal flavours, with an emphasis on sustainable production using local ingredients and suppliers.
The online auction opens on the 10th of November and bidding closes on the 17th of November. Equipment available in the auction includes 2017 KHS 400 BPM Innofill rotary glass bottling line, Labelling equipment, (2) Pearson 6-pack erector / stuffer, ABC case erector and sealer, date coder and conveyor. The assets are located in Milwaukee, Wisconsin and can be inspected by appointment with the auctioneer only.
